在数字化时代,微信小程序凭借其便捷性和易用性,成为了开发者们关注的焦点。对于想要踏入这个领域的初学者来说,一本合适的入门指南显得尤为重要。下面,我将为大家详细介绍一本适合零基础学习微信小程序开发的电子书,帮助大家从零开始,一步步走向实战精通。
第一章:微信小程序概述
1.1 微信小程序的定义与特点
微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的概念,用户扫一扫或搜一下即可打开应用。这种应用不需要安装即可快速打开,实现“即用即走”的理念,具有无需下载、即搜即用的特点。
1.2 微信小程序的发展历程
微信小程序自2016年发布以来,已经经历了多个版本迭代,功能越来越丰富,应用场景也越来越广泛。本章将简要介绍微信小程序的发展历程。
第二章:微信小程序开发环境搭建
2.1 开发工具介绍
微信小程序开发主要使用微信开发者工具,本章将介绍如何下载、安装和配置微信开发者工具。
2.2 开发环境搭建
本章将详细介绍如何搭建微信小程序开发环境,包括配置开发工具、注册小程序、购买服务器等。
第三章:微信小程序基本语法
3.1 WXML语法
WXML(WeChat Markup Language)是微信小程序的页面结构语言,类似于HTML。本章将介绍WXML的基本语法和常用标签。
3.2 WXSS语法
WXSS(WeChat Style Sheets)是微信小程序的样式表语言,类似于CSS。本章将介绍WXSS的基本语法和常用样式。
3.3 JavaScript语法
JavaScript是微信小程序的逻辑层语言,本章将介绍JavaScript的基本语法和常用函数。
第四章:微信小程序组件与API
4.1 常用组件介绍
微信小程序提供了丰富的组件,本章将介绍一些常用组件,如视图容器、表单组件、媒体组件等。
4.2 常用API介绍
微信小程序提供了丰富的API,本章将介绍一些常用API,如网络请求、文件操作、页面路由等。
第五章:微信小程序实战案例
5.1 案例1:天气查询小程序
本章将通过一个天气查询小程序的实战案例,详细介绍微信小程序的开发流程,包括页面设计、功能实现、数据交互等。
5.2 案例2:待办事项小程序
本章将通过一个待办事项小程序的实战案例,介绍如何使用微信小程序实现用户数据的存储和读取。
第六章:微信小程序性能优化
6.1 优化页面加载速度
本章将介绍如何优化页面加载速度,提高用户体验。
6.2 优化代码执行效率
本章将介绍如何优化代码执行效率,提高小程序的性能。
第七章:微信小程序安全与合规
7.1 数据安全
本章将介绍微信小程序的数据安全问题,以及如何保障用户数据安全。
7.2 合规性要求
本章将介绍微信小程序的合规性要求,以及如何遵守相关规定。
第八章:微信小程序运营与推广
8.1 运营策略
本章将介绍微信小程序的运营策略,包括如何提高用户活跃度、如何进行推广等。
8.2 推广渠道
本章将介绍微信小程序的推广渠道,如微信广告、朋友圈推广等。
结语
通过阅读这本电子书,相信你已经对微信小程序开发有了全面的了解。从零基础到实战精通,关键在于不断实践和总结。希望这本书能帮助你顺利进入微信小程序开发领域,成为一名优秀的小程序开发者。最后,祝愿你在微信小程序开发的道路上越走越远,收获满满!
